Can anyone tell me what Chevy rear ends if any beyond 87 will fit in an 85 C10 1/2 ton as a direct bolt on?  Can you also tell me how to determine the gear ratios based on the housing markings?  THX
Title: Re: Rearend
Post by: VileZambonie on May 13, 2009, 02:00:02 pm
87-91 RV series are a direct fit. Axle ratio's aren't stamped on the housing.

What would it take to install a newer year model rear end in the C10?
Title: Re: Rearend
Post by: HAULIN IT on May 13, 2009, 03:23:38 pm
The spring perches/shock mounts are in different locations. The brake lines & E-brake cables are different & depending on the year/application...maybe the wheel bolt pattern. Do-able, but no where near a bolt-in deal. Lorne
